Historically, South Indian cinema and North Indian pop culture operated in parallel lanes. However, the last five years have demolished those barriers. The term "Mallu Desi" signifies the organic blend of Malayali finesse (stunning visuals, realistic storytelling, raw action) with the mass-appeal "Desi" flavor (relatable humor, rhythmic music, and pan-Indian star power).
